    I live in south-west Ontario. To all who watch this review: don't get your hopes up that stores as good as this are in all towns. This store is only in major centers like Toronto or Ottawa and is an upscale store chain owned by Loblaws. Most grocery supermarkets do not carry such a variety of mushrooms, for ex., just 1 or 2 types. Especially Walmart has much less variety than other stores like Real Canadian Super Store. They have even shut down their deli counters.😡 And the discount grocery chains, such as No Frills (owned by Loblaws), are the same but prices are cheaper. If you want the variety shown in this video then go to dedicated fruit/veg stores like Longos. Also go to farmers markets when they are open in the spring/summer.

    "Why are red peppers more expensive...?" The difference between a green pepper and a red/orange pepper is two (2) weeks. They all grow big as green and then turn yellow/orange/red over the next few days. At the same time their taste evolves better. But a farmer can grow more fruit in that time with an earlier harvest and make more money. So it costs more for the farmer to wait an extra 2-3 weeks. Lately they are selling packaged peppers in 3's or/yel/red and separate greens. Greens are still cheaper/lb/Kilo but the colourful ones are not so bad. 3 peppers in a bag is about 1 lb and taste better.
